SUSCOM
7th Annual International Sustainability Conference (SUSCON VII) of Indian Institute of
Management Shillong is during November 29 - December 1, 2018. Since inception, IIM Shillong
has always given thrust on Sustainability, covering its multiple dimensions. The theme of
sustainability is integrated in its various academic and corporate programmes. It offers a
global platform for dialogues and deliberations on various aspects of Sustainability from all
stakeholders including academicians, business leaders, NGOs, social activists and policy
makers. Eminent scholars and experts have shared their valuable insights on var ious aspects
of Sustainability in SUSCON over the years.

ALTERNATIVE TO PLASTIC BOTTLE IN SUSCOM

Bamboo the longest grass, predominant in Assam which can be handcrafted to design various
objects, tools and importantly cooking tools, pots and Bamboo water bottle to keep water. The
disposable plastic bottles are very bad for health and in summer cannot be used as it becomes
hot. It is a responsible choice of material as it is easily recyclable, durable and can be used
repeatedly. It does not cause any harm to our environment as it is made by biodegradable things.
This eco-friendly bottle comes in various sizes. It is like any other plastic water bottle with a
cork so that water has no chance of leaking also during the process of manufacturing the bottles
are extensively treated to make them bacteria free, hygienic and safe for storing human
consumable water in all environment

WHAT ARE THE WAYS TO PROCURING IT?

There are various craftsman and entrepreneurs in Assam who are involve in producing eco-
friendly bamboo water bottle. By making tie up with them we can procure the water bottle
at cheap rates and in return we can provide them the opportunity to represent themselves at
International level, by making them our sponsor.
